The Video Source Provider (VSP)
is a mobile computer system with a high resolution
camera. This portable setup utilizes a wireless link to
the UpLink Station (ULS) nearby. With a roaming range
of up to 6 miles from the ULS, the mobile VSP has
virtually unlimited and un-tethered access throughout a
job site.
The UpLink Station (ULS) located onsite or nearby, is
connected physically to the internet using an available
transport (Dialup, DSL, T1, etc..). As the ULS receives
the wireless signal from the mobile VSP, data is
transmitted out to an Internet Service Provider (ISP)
for viewing remotely by clients. At the same time all
video footage is recorded and archived for later review.
A Client Workstation can be
any computer connected to the internet using a standard
browser such as Netscape or Microsoft Internet Explorer
5.5 or later. There may be multiple participants from
multiple locations on the internet. |
